A commercial office relocation in Dubai requires strategic planning to minimize operational downtime and protect valuable business assets. From relocating IT server racks and modular workstations to satisfying commercial building management guidelines, professional commercial movers ensure business continuity.
Key Phases of Commercial Office Relocation
Coordinate with specialized IT movers to back up data, label network cables, dismantle server racks, and safely transport sensitive hardware in anti-static packaging.
Commercial grade desks, glass partitions, and executive conference tables require specialized carpentry tools for safe breakdown and re-fitment.
Commercial towers across Business Bay, DIFC, and JLT strictly restrict office moves to after-hours or weekends (Friday evening through Sunday) to avoid disturbing other corporate tenants.
Commercial Moving Checklist for Business Managers
- Update trade license address with Dubai Economy & Tourism (DET) or your Free Zone Authority (DIFC, DMCC, DAFZA).
- Arrange commercial telecom & fiber-optic internet transfer with du or Etisalat e& at least 2 weeks before move day.
- Label all crate boxes with employee names and desk numbers matching your new floor plan layout.
- Schedule a post-move office deep clean and reinstatement fit-out work for the old premises.
